- Scope & Content
- Series consists of two sub-series: A. General commercial work, ca.1950-1971, ca.30,000 negatives. Includes a wide variety of portrait, events, commercial, project and convention photographs. Notable are photographs of Banff Winter Carnival and the Banff School of Fine Arts. B. Passport and citizenship photographs, 1958-1959, 1966-1970, ca.2000 negatives
